+ADTRAN-AOSCPU DEFINITIONS ::= BEGIN
+
+IMPORTS
+ Integer32, Gauge32, OBJECT-TYPE, MODULE-IDENTITY,
+ Unsigned32, NOTIFICATION-TYPE, OBJECT-IDENTITY
+ FROM SNMPv2-SMI
+ DisplayString, RowStatus
+ FROM SNMPv2-TC
+ MODULE-COMPLIANCE, OBJECT-GROUP, NOTIFICATION-GROUP
+ FROM SNMPv2-CONF
+ sysName
+ FROM SNMPv2-MIB
+ adIdentityShared
+ FROM ADTRAN-MIB
+ adGenAOSCommon, adGenAOSConformance
+ FROM ADTRAN-AOS;
+
+adGenAOSCpuUtilMib MODULE-IDENTITY
+ LAST-UPDATED "200904300000Z" -- April 30, 2009
+ ORGANIZATION "ADTRAN, Inc."
+ CONTACT-INFO
+ "Technical Support Dept.
+ Postal: ADTRAN, Inc.
+ 901 Explorer Blvd.
+ Huntsville, AL 35806
+
+ Tel: +1 800 726-8663
+ Fax: +1 256 963 6217
+ E-mail: support@adtran.com"
+
+ DESCRIPTION
+ "This MIB contains information regarding CPU utilization, Memory usage
+ and system process status."
+
+ REVISION "200410040000Z" -- October 24, 2004
+ DESCRIPTION
+ "Initial version of this MIB module."
+
+ REVISION "200904300000Z" -- April 30, 2009
+ DESCRIPTION
+ "Added resource utilization OIDs for traps and tables."
+
+ REVISION "200908130000Z" -- August 13, 2009
+ DESCRIPTION
+ "Added sysName to adGenAOSResUtilThreshAlarm and
+ adGenAOSResUtilThreshNormal."
+
+ ::= { adIdentityShared 4 }
+
+adGenAOSCpuUtil OBJECT IDENTIFIER ::= { adGenAOSCommon 4 }
+
+--
+-- Unit CPU and Memory Utilization Group
+--
+
+-- Trap OID
+adGenAOSResUtilThreshTraps OBJECT-IDENTITY
+ STATUS current
+ DESCRIPTION
+ "These traps indicate that a resource's utilization status has changed
+ respective of a set threshold value. There are two types of traps,
+ Alarm and Normal. The traps will return the adGenAOSResUtilThreshTable
+ indices and the number of seconds since epoch as a timestamp
+ indicating when the utilization status changed. The timestamp value is
+ indicative of when the utilization status changed an not when the trap
+ was sent."
+ ::= { adGenAOSCpuUtil 0 }
+
+adGenAOSCurrentCpuUtil OBJECT-TYPE
+ SYNTAX Gauge32(0..100)
+ MAX-ACCESS read-only
+ STATUS current
+ DESCRIPTION
+ "Average CPU utilization over the last second."
+ ::= { adGenAOSCpuUtil 1 }
+
+adGenAOSClearUtilizationStats OBJECT-TYPE
+ SYNTAX INTEGER {
+ reset(1)
+ }
+ MAX-ACCESS read-write
+ STATUS current
+ DESCRIPTION
+ "Set value to 1 to clear CPU utilization statistics."
+ ::= { adGenAOSCpuUtil 2 }
+
+adGenAOS1MinCpuUtil OBJECT-TYPE
+ SYNTAX Gauge32(0..100)
+ MAX-ACCESS read-only
+ STATUS current
+ DESCRIPTION
+ "Average CPU utilization over the last minute."
+ ::= { adGenAOSCpuUtil 3 }
+
+adGenAOS5MinCpuUtil OBJECT-TYPE
+ SYNTAX Gauge32(0..100)
+ MAX-ACCESS read-only
+ STATUS current
+ DESCRIPTION
+ "Average CPU utilization over the last 5 minutes."
+ ::= { adGenAOSCpuUtil 4 }
+
+adGenAOSMaxCpuUtil OBJECT-TYPE
+ SYNTAX Gauge32(0..100)
+ MAX-ACCESS read-only
+ STATUS current
+ DESCRIPTION
+ "Maximum CPU utilization since last system reboot or
+ statistics reset."
+ ::= { adGenAOSCpuUtil 5 }
+
+adGenAOSMemPool OBJECT-TYPE
+ SYNTAX Gauge32
+ MAX-ACCESS read-only
+ STATUS current
+ DESCRIPTION
+ "Total memory pool available."
+ ::= { adGenAOSCpuUtil 6 }
+
+adGenAOSHeapSize OBJECT-TYPE
+ SYNTAX Gauge32
+ MAX-ACCESS read-only
+ STATUS current
+ DESCRIPTION
+ "Total Heap size. This is the amount of memory available after the
+ code is decompressed and packet buffers are allocated."
+ ::= { adGenAOSCpuUtil 7 }
+
+adGenAOSHeapFree OBJECT-TYPE
+ SYNTAX Gauge32
+ MAX-ACCESS read-only
+ STATUS current
+ DESCRIPTION
+ "Current amount of heap available for use."
+ ::= { adGenAOSCpuUtil 8 }

+--
+-- System Process Table
+--
+adGenAOSProcessTable OBJECT-TYPE
+ SYNTAX SEQUENCE OF AdGenAOSProcessEntry
+ MAX-ACCESS not-accessible
+ STATUS current
+ DESCRIPTION
+ "A table reporting the current run state of all current processes."
+ ::= { adGenAOSCpuUtil 9 }
+
+adGenAOSProcessEntry OBJECT-TYPE
+ SYNTAX AdGenAOSProcessEntry
+ MAX-ACCESS not-accessible
+ STATUS current
+ DESCRIPTION
+ "Each entry in the list is a current system process."
+ INDEX { adGenAOSProcID }
+ ::= { adGenAOSProcessTable 1 }
+
+AdGenAOSProcessEntry ::=
+ SEQUENCE {
+ adGenAOSProcID Integer32,
+ adGenAOSProcName DisplayString,
+ adGenAOSProcPriority Integer32,
+ adGenAOSProcState INTEGER,
+ adGenAOSProcCount Gauge32,
+ adGenAOSProcExecTime Gauge32,
+ adGenAOSProcRunTime Gauge32,
+ adGenAOSProc1SecLd Gauge32
+ }
+
+adGenAOSProcID OBJECT-TYPE
+ SYNTAX Integer32(0..65535)
+ MAX-ACCESS not-accessible
+ STATUS current
+ DESCRIPTION
+ "Unique indentifier for the process."
+ ::= { adGenAOSProcessEntry 1 }
+
+adGenAOSProcName OBJECT-TYPE
+ SYNTAX DisplayString
+ MAX-ACCESS read-only
+ STATUS current
+ DESCRIPTION
+ "System process name."
+ ::= { adGenAOSProcessEntry 2 }
+
+adGenAOSProcPriority OBJECT-TYPE
+ SYNTAX Integer32(0..255)
+ MAX-ACCESS read-only
+ STATUS current
+ DESCRIPTION
+ "Current system process priority."
+ ::= { adGenAOSProcessEntry 3 }
+
+adGenAOSProcState OBJECT-TYPE
+ SYNTAX INTEGER {
+ running(1),
+ ready(2),
+ wait(3)
+ }
+ MAX-ACCESS read-only
+ STATUS current
+ DESCRIPTION
+ "Current system process state."
+ ::= { adGenAOSProcessEntry 4 }
+
+adGenAOSProcCount OBJECT-TYPE
+ SYNTAX Gauge32(0..4294967295)
+ MAX-ACCESS read-only
+ STATUS current
+ DESCRIPTION
+ "Current number of times the process has been invoked."
+ ::= { adGenAOSProcessEntry 5 }
+
+adGenAOSProcExecTime OBJECT-TYPE
+ SYNTAX Gauge32(0..4294967295)
+ MAX-ACCESS read-only
+ STATUS current
+ DESCRIPTION
+ "Total amount of time spent executing this process. Result is
+ in usec."
+ ::= { adGenAOSProcessEntry 6 }
+
+adGenAOSProcRunTime OBJECT-TYPE
+ SYNTAX Gauge32(0..4294967295)
+ MAX-ACCESS read-only
+ STATUS current
+ DESCRIPTION
+ "Total amount of time spent executing this process. Result is
+ in usec."
+ ::= { adGenAOSProcessEntry 7 }
+
+adGenAOSProc1SecLd OBJECT-TYPE
+ SYNTAX Gauge32(0..100)
+ MAX-ACCESS read-only
+ STATUS current
+ DESCRIPTION
+ "Percent system utilization for the process."
+ ::= { adGenAOSProcessEntry 8 }
+
+--
+-- Resource Utilization Threshold Table
+--
+adGenAOSResUtilThreshTable OBJECT-TYPE
+ SYNTAX SEQUENCE OF AdGenAOSResUtilThreshEntry
+ MAX-ACCESS not-accessible
+ STATUS current
+ DESCRIPTION
+ "A table reporting the current resource utilization threshold traps
+ with abilities to configure the traps. The table supports create and
+ destroy. To prevent abuse, the table will not support row creation
+ once 20 or more entries exist within the table."
+ ::= { adGenAOSCpuUtil 10 }
+
+adGenAOSResUtilThreshEntry OBJECT-TYPE
+ SYNTAX AdGenAOSResUtilThreshEntry
+ MAX-ACCESS not-accessible
+ STATUS current
+ DESCRIPTION
+ "Each entry in the table represents a current resource utilization
+ threshold notification. The entry is composed of an enumerated
+ integer representing the resource type, the numerical threshold and
+ time interval settings. All entries are immutable and all columns are
+ required for create."
+ INDEX {
+ adGenAOSResType,
+ adGenAOSResUtilThresh,
+ adGenAOSResUtilTimeInterval
+ }
+ ::= { adGenAOSResUtilThreshTable 1 }
+
+AdGenAOSResUtilThreshEntry ::=
+ SEQUENCE {
+ adGenAOSResType INTEGER,
+ adGenAOSResUtilThresh Gauge32,
+ adGenAOSResUtilTimeInterval Gauge32,
+ adGenAOSResUtilThreshRowStatus RowStatus
+ }
+
+adGenAOSResType OBJECT-TYPE
+ SYNTAX INTEGER {
+ cpu(1),
+ heap(2)
+ }
+ MAX-ACCESS read-create
+ STATUS current
+ DESCRIPTION
+ "Indentifier specifying the resource type.
+ Resource notes:
+ (2) Heap - The heap resource will only display a time interval value
+ of 1. Setting the value to a valid time interval value will always
+ result in the inherent default value of 1. A heap notification will
+ occur whenever the threshold is exceeded."
+ ::= { adGenAOSResUtilThreshEntry 1 }
+
+adGenAOSResUtilThresh OBJECT-TYPE
+ SYNTAX Gauge32(1..100)
+ MAX-ACCESS read-create
+ STATUS current
+ DESCRIPTION
+ "The utilization threshold value expressed as a whole number
+ percentage."
+ ::= { adGenAOSResUtilThreshEntry 2 }
+
+adGenAOSResUtilTimeInterval OBJECT-TYPE
+ SYNTAX Gauge32(1..86400) -- 86400 seconds = 1 day
+ MAX-ACCESS read-create
+ STATUS current
+ DESCRIPTION
+ "Time interval in seconds for actual to exceed threshold."
+ ::= { adGenAOSResUtilThreshEntry 3 }
+
+adGenAOSResUtilThreshRowStatus OBJECT-TYPE
+ SYNTAX RowStatus
+ MAX-ACCESS read-create
+ STATUS current
+ DESCRIPTION
+ "RowStatus column for this table. Since each entry is immutable the
+ only acceptable RowStatus values (for set) are createAndGo(4) and
+ destroy(6). The only acceptable RowStatus value for get is
+ active(1)."
+ ::= { adGenAOSResUtilThreshEntry 4 }
+
+adGenAOSResUtilThreshTimestamp OBJECT-TYPE
+ SYNTAX Unsigned32
+ MAX-ACCESS accessible-for-notify
+ STATUS current
+ DESCRIPTION
+ "The time (seconds since epoch) that a resource utilization
+ threshold trap condition occurred and not necessarily the when
+ the trap was sent."
+ ::= { adGenAOSCpuUtil 11 }
+
+-- Traps
+adGenAOSResUtilThreshAlarm NOTIFICATION-TYPE
+ OBJECTS {
+ adGenAOSResType,
+ adGenAOSResUtilThresh,
+ adGenAOSResUtilTimeInterval,
+ adGenAOSResUtilThreshTimestamp,
+ sysName
+ }
+ STATUS current
+ DESCRIPTION
+ "This trap indicates the resource utilization exceeded the set
+ threshold value for the entirety of the set time interval. The
+ specific resource utilization is specified via the indexes
+ adGenAOSResType, adGenAOSResUtilThresh, and
+ adGenAOSResUtilTimeInterval. The adGenAOSResUtilThreshTimestamp
+ indicates when this condition occurred and not necessarily when the
+ trap was sent. The sysName is the exact same as defined in
+ SNMPv2-MIB."
+ ::= { adGenAOSResUtilThreshTraps 1 }
+
+adGenAOSResUtilThreshNormal NOTIFICATION-TYPE
+ OBJECTS {
+ adGenAOSResType,
+ adGenAOSResUtilThresh,
+ adGenAOSResUtilTimeInterval,
+ adGenAOSResUtilThreshTimestamp,
+ sysName
+ }
+ STATUS current
+ DESCRIPTION
+ "This trap indicates the resource utilization has been in a normal
+ (non-alarm) state for at least 5 seconds. This condition can only
+ occur after the alarm state has been triggered. The specific
+ resource utilization is specified via the indexes adGenAOSResType,
+ adGenAOSResUtilThresh, and adGenAOSResUtilTimeInterval. The
+ adGenAOSResUtilThreshTimestamp indicates when this condition
+ occurred and not necessarily when the trap was sent.The sysName is
+ the exact same as defined in SNMPv2-MIB."
+ ::= { adGenAOSResUtilThreshTraps 2 }
